2188 NEW ZEALAND GAZETTE, No. 74 30 JUNE 2006
Hazardous Substances and New Organisms Act 1996
Pursuant to section 96B of the Hazardous Substances and New Organisms Act 1996 (the Act),
the Environmental Risk Management Authority, on its own initiative, gives notice of the issue of
this Group Standard.
1 Title
Lubricants (Low Hazard) Group Standard 2006
HSNO Approval Number
The HSNO Approval Number for this Group Standard is HSR002605.
2 Commencement
This Group Standard comes into force on 1 July 2006 and applies to substances under
section 96B(2)(a), (b) and (c) of the Act.
3 Scope of Group Standard
Substances covered by Group Standard
(1) This Group Standard applies to solid or liquid substances that are imported or
manufactured for use as a lubricant.
(2) A substance referred to in subclause (1) must have one or more of the following (but
only the following) hazards:
(a) acute toxicity, HSNO 6.1E classification (including aspiration hazard);
(b) skin irritancy, HSNO 6.3A or 6.3B classification;
(c) eye irritancy, HSNO 6.4A classification;
(d) ecotoxicity, HSNO 9.1D classification.
Substances excluded from Group Standard
(3) This Group Standard excludes any fuel.
(4) No substance shall be permitted under this Group Standard if it contains a chemical that
is a mutagen or reproductive toxicant that is not listed on the Inventory of Chemicals,
unless—
(a) the new mutagen or reproductive toxicant is used to completely replace an
existing mutagen or reproductive toxicant in the substance; and
(b) the new mutagen or reproductive toxicant has a lower hazard classification than
the existing mutagen or reproductive toxicant; and
(c) clause 17 of Schedule 1 is complied with.
